The A's manager and their hottest hitter both left early Saturday and a deep homer off a familiar foe haunted Oakland in New York.
The Yankees scored twice in the bottom of the sixth and held on to their 3-2 lead, handing the A's a road loss.
Jharel Cotton pitched 5 2/3 innings in his first game back from the minors. He allowed all three runs and struck out five. Cotton is now 3-5 with a 5.56 ERA this season.
Josh Phegley hit his second home run of the year in the seventh inning.
